Kevin Gaddy, 20-Year Employee, Dies
Kevin Gaddy, a 20-year Grey Eagle employee, died October 16. Mr. Gaddy had been in declining health since a fall at his home almost two years ago but had continued to work and contribute to Grey Eagle’s success.

Mr. Gaddy joined Grey Eagle in 1983 as a Project Marketing Team member. He later was a Sales Representative, Customer Service Representative and, at the time of his death, was a Merchandiser/Graphics Services Coordinator.

"Kevin lived the Anheuser-Busch motto of ‘making friends is our business,’ for half of our company’s history" said Jerry G. Clinton, President and Chairman of Grey Eagle. "He brightened the day of everyone he met and he is missed by his friends here and throughout the community."

 
 

Komadoski Inducted Into Manitoba Hockey Hall of Fame
Neil Komadoski, Vice President–Operations at Grey Eagle, was inducted into the Manitoba Hockey Hall of Fame during ceremonies October 3 in Winnipeg, Canada.

Mr. Komadoski, who played for the Los Angeles Kings and St. Louis Blues during an eight-year National Hockey League career, was one of 11 inductees and one of six former players inducted.

During his NHL career, Mr. Komadoski was a defenseman who scored 92 points in 502 games.

He joined Grey Eagle in 1985 as Manager of Customer Service and was promoted to his current position in 1998.

 
 

Oldani Announces Promotion, New Employee
Andrew Davis has joined Grey Eagle as a Sales Assistant and former Sales Assistant Todd Hunter has been promoted to Sales Representative according to Dann Oldani, Manager of Sales and Marketing.

Mr. Davis is reporting to Area Sales Manager Joe Timmermann. A native of St. Louis, he is a graduate of Hazelwood Central High School and attended St. Louis Community College at Florissant Valley. He was employed at Schnucks prior to joining Grey Eagle this summer.

Mr. Hunter is now reporting to Area Sales Manager Jim Burke. He joined Grey Eagle in 2001 as a Merchandiser/Van Deliveries and was promoted to Sales Assistant last year.

Meeting Room Used For Many Activities
Grey Eagle’s large sales and meeting room on the top floor of the Sales and Marketing building has been the scene of many important activities since it was built in the mid-1980s.

It was in that room that news conferences have been held, sales meetings have been conducted, TIPS and Bar Code training sessions have been attended and a host of miscellaneous other events.
The facility is equipped with state of the art audio and video equipment that enables the use of ever-changing presentation formats.

Grey Eagle has also provided the room has also used for a variety of Anheuser-Busch meetings for sales, marketing and training activities. Most recently, it was the location for a statewide meeting for Anheuser-Busch wholesalers on availability of point-of-sale materials.

Another meeting trained space management coordinators to use new Anheuser-Busch software to increase the effectiveness of shelf-sets. That meeting was attended by wholesaler representatives from throughout the Midwest.
